Wheaton Lions find lost ring in Candy Day donation jar

The Wheaton Lions Club Candy Days were a great success. Club members wish to thank all who participated.

They also have a special message for the wonderful lady who donated on Wheaton’s Candy Day last Friday, Oct. 8. You accidentally lost your ring when you were placing your donation into one of the milk bottle collection holders.

If you recently lost your ring, contact the Wheaton Lions Club at (630) 370-1731, with an accurate description and they will return your ring to you.

The Wheaton Lions Club provides Six Pillars of Service in the community – Sight, Hearing, Diabetes, Hunger, Environment, and Pediatric Cancer.
